Cocci are bacteria that have what shape?

Explanation:
Cocci are spherical bacteria. The term cocci describes a round, ball-like shape, so round-shaped is the correct description. Other common bacterial shapes include rods (bacilli), spirals (spirilla or spirochetes), and comma-shaped forms (vibrios). Recognizing that cocci are round helps you recall which organisms are being referred to in common skin infections and why certain hygiene precautions are important in esthetic practice.
